Village Wrench Free Bike Repair

Our monthly free bike repair events are all across Greenville County and ensure that all have access to bike maintenance and safe riding. They are a great opportunity to build relationships with your neighbors, turn a wrench, do crafts with kids, or serve up a hot dog. Village Launch Business Entrepreneur Academy Graduation

Village Launch’s Business Entrepreneur Academy (BEA) is a 10-week, cohort-based program that equips entrepreneurs of all backgrounds with the insights, relationships, and tools needed to turn ideas into action. Join these entrepreneurs at their BEA graduation, celebrating a major step in building or expanding their business!

Gratefull GVL

Join the whole Greenville community as we come together at one long table over the Main Street bridge to celebrate diversity and inclusion, to share a meal and a conversation. Gratefull GVL is not a handout; it is a handshake. It is a way for us to connect to our friends, neighbors and co-workers, across all socioeconomic, ethnic, and cultural segments.

Village Engage Faith & Justice Fourth Friday Conversation Series

Join Village Engage on fourth Fridays for information and dialogue about opportunities to address injustices and to advance economic equity in Greenville and across South Carolina. This hybrid lunch & learn series is in-person at the Mill Village Ministries Office on Pendleton Street and on Zoom.

February’s conversation is about eviction laws and what religious institutions can do to support affordable housing. Rep. Wendell Jones and SC ACLU's Paul Bowers will lead this important discussion in person at the Mill Village Ministries Office on Pendleton Street.
